FLSA EXEMPTION FROM OVERTIME The FLSA categorizes all workers as either covered by the law and, therefore, subject to FLSA minimum wage and overtime provisions (“nonexempt”), or, exempted from the law and, therefore, not subject to the FLSA minimum wage and overtime provisions (“exempt”).
